数控技术专业编程语言是什么

worktile 其他 2

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    数控技术专业编程语言是G代码(G-code)。

    G代码是数控机床上常用的一种编程语言,用于控制机床进行加工操作。它是一种简单的文本格式,由一系列指令组成,每个指令都以字母G开头,后跟一到两个数字。这些指令告诉机床如何进行移动、切削、速度控制等操作。

    G代码中的指令包括轴向移动指令、速度控制指令、刀具控制指令等。轴向移动指令用于控制机床的各个轴向进行移动,例如X轴、Y轴、Z轴等。速度控制指令用于控制机床的运动速度,包括进给速度和主轴转速。刀具控制指令用于控制机床上的刀具进行切削操作,例如切削深度、刀具半径等。

    在编写G代码时,需要考虑工件的几何形状、刀具的类型和尺寸、加工方式等因素。通过合理的编程,可以实现复杂的加工操作,如铣削、钻孔、车削等。

    除了G代码,数控技术还常用其他编程语言,如M代码、T代码等。M代码用于控制机床的辅助功能,如冷却液开关、主轴启停等。T代码用于选择机床上的刀具。

    总之,数控技术专业编程语言主要是G代码,它是一种简单而强大的语言,用于控制数控机床进行各种加工操作。掌握G代码编程对于数控技术专业人员来说是非常重要的。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    数控技术专业编程语言主要包括G代码和M代码。

    1. G代码:G代码是数控机床编程中最常用的一种指令代码。它是一种用于控制数控机床运动的指令系统,包括直线插补、圆弧插补、刀具补偿、速度控制等功能。G代码的格式一般为字母G后面跟着一个或多个数字,用于指定不同的机床运动方式。例如,G00用于快速定位,G01用于直线插补,G02和G03用于圆弧插补等。

    2. M代码:M代码是数控机床编程中用于控制机床辅助功能的指令代码。它包括开关机、启动停止主轴、冷却液、切割液等辅助设备的操作。M代码的格式一般为字母M后面跟着一个或多个数字,用于指定不同的机床辅助功能。例如,M03用于启动主轴正转,M04用于启动主轴反转,M05用于停止主轴等。

    3. G代码和M代码的组合:在数控机床编程中,常常需要同时使用G代码和M代码来完成复杂的加工任务。例如,G01和M03可以组合使用来实现主轴正转和直线插补,G02和M05可以组合使用来实现主轴停止和圆弧插补。

    4. 常见的G代码和M代码功能:数控机床编程中常用的G代码包括G00、G01、G02、G03、G04等;常用的M代码包括M03、M04、M05、M06、M08、M09等。不同的机床厂商和不同的机床控制系统可能会有一些特殊的G代码和M代码,需要根据具体的机床和控制系统来编写相应的程序。

    5. 编程语言的选择:数控技术专业的编程语言主要是G代码和M代码,这是因为数控机床的控制系统一般采用的是基于G代码和M代码的编程语言。掌握这两种编程语言对于从事数控加工工作的人员来说是非常重要的,可以实现对机床运动和辅助功能的精确控制,完成各种复杂的加工任务。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    数控技术专业编程语言是指用于编写数控机床程序的计算机语言。数控技术是一种通过计算机控制机床运动和加工工件的技术,它可以实现高精度、高效率的加工过程。编程语言是数控技术的关键,它决定了机床的加工方式、运动轨迹、切削参数等。

    在数控技术中,常用的编程语言有以下几种:

    1. G代码:G代码是数控编程中最常用的语言,它是一种基于文本的语言,用于描述机床的运动和加工操作。G代码由一系列的指令组成,每个指令都以字母“G”开头,后面跟着一个数字。不同的数字代表不同的操作,如G00表示快速定位,G01表示直线插补等。通过编写G代码,可以控制机床进行各种加工操作。

    2. M代码:M代码是数控编程中用于控制机床辅助功能的语言,如启动、停止、换刀、冷却等。M代码也是一种基于文本的语言,每个指令以字母“M”开头,后面跟着一个数字。不同的数字代表不同的功能,如M03表示主轴正转,M05表示主轴停止等。通过编写M代码,可以实现机床的各种辅助功能。

    3. ISO标准:ISO标准是一种通用的数控编程语言,它由国际标准化组织(ISO)制定,用于描述机床的加工过程。ISO标准包括G代码和M代码,同时还包括一些其他的指令,如T代码用于刀具选择,F代码用于进给速度控制等。通过编写ISO标准程序,可以实现复杂的机床加工操作。

    除了上述几种常用的编程语言外,还有一些专用的编程语言,如APT(自动程序生成技术)语言、CAM(计算机辅助制造)语言等。这些语言通常由专业的数控软件提供,可以实现更高级的数控编程功能。

    总之,数控技术专业编程语言是用于编写数控机床程序的计算机语言,常用的编程语言包括G代码、M代码、ISO标准等。通过编写这些语言的程序,可以实现机床的各种加工操作和辅助功能。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部